Aracılığıyla paylaş


CFileDialog::SetTemplate

Ayarlar iletişim kutusunda şablonu CFileDialog nesnesi.

void SetTemplate(
   UINT nWin3ID,
   UINT nWin4ID 
);
void SetTemplate(
   LPCTSTR lpWin3ID,
   LPCTSTR lpWin4ID 
);

Parametreler

  • [in]nWin3ID
    Explorer'a ait olmayan şablon kaynağın kimlik numarası içeren CFileDialog nesnesi.Bu şablonu, yalnızca Windows NT 3.51 veya ofn_explorer stil olmadığında kullanılır.

  • [in]nWin4ID
    Explorer için şablon kaynak kimliği numarasını içerir CFileDialog nesnesi.Bu şablon yalnızca kullanılan Windows NT 4.0 ve sonraki sürümleri, Windows 95 ve sonraki sürümler ya da ne zaman ofn_explorer stil yok.

  • [in]lpWin3ID
    Explorer'a ait olmayan şablon kaynağını adını içerir CFileDialog nesnesi.Bu şablonu, yalnızca Windows NT 3.51 veya ofn_explorer stil olmadığında kullanılır.

  • [in]lpWin4ID
    Explorer şablon kaynağın adını içeren CFileDialog nesnesi.Bu şablon yalnızca kullanılan Windows NT 4.0 ve sonraki sürümleri, Windows 95 ve sonraki sürümler ya da ne zaman ofn_explorer stil yok.

Notlar

Sistem belirtilen şablonları yalnızca birini kullanın.Sistem ofn_explorer stil ve uygulama üzerinde çalıştığı işletim sisteminin varlığını kullanılacak şablonu esas belirler.Explorer'a ait olmayan ve Explorer stil şablonu belirterek, destek Windows NT 3.51 kolaydır Windows NT 4.0 ve sonraki sürümlerinde ve Windows 95 ve sonraki sürümler.

[!NOT]

Windows Vistastili dosya iletişim kutularında bu işlevi desteklemez.Bu işlevi kullanmayı denemeden bir Windows Vista stili dosya iletişim kutusu throw CNotSupportedException.Daha fazla bilgi için bkz. CFileDialog sınıfı.Özelleştirilmiş bir iletişim kutusu kullanmak için alternatif yoludur.Özel bir kullanma hakkında daha fazla bilgi için CFileDialog, bkz: IFileDialogCustomize.

Gereksinimler

**Başlık:**afxdlgs.h

Ayrıca bkz.

Başvuru

CFileDialog sınıfı

Hiyerarşi grafik